  • KristineHermosaKristine Hermosa assumed the role of a saleslady on October 12, at the SM Supermarket in Megamall, Mandaluyong City. The Kapamilya actress was joined by fellow stars Empress Schuck, Miriam Quiambao, Melissa Ricks, and Maja Salvador, in personally as­sisting the shoppers, which is part of Procter & Gamble’s 75th anniver­sary celebration.Each of the stars was assigned to man a particular stall containing some of the brands being manu­factured by the multinational com­pany. Kristine, who was tasked to patrol the booth of a shampoo brand, was an instant hit with the buyers, who made the most of the rare occasion by having their pictures taken with the mestiza actress.

    “Nag-enjoy ako. Gustong-gusto ko talaga ‘yong nagtitinda,” beamed Kristine after the brief morning ac­tivity.The activity, added Kristine, en­able the buying public to interact personally with their favorite celeb­rities, rather than just seeing them on towering billboards along the highways and on TV commercials played intermittently throughout the day.
    WAITING FOR A FILM PROJECT.
    With the 36th Metro Manila Film Festival only a few months away, many are wondering if they will see Kristine again in one of the movie entries.
    Kristine’s track record in the annual Christmas film festival is impressive, having appeared four times in the highly successful En­teng Kabisote franchise in 2004, 2005, 2006, and 2007. Ace Comedian Vic Sotto, how­ever, decided to take a break from fielding an Enteng Kabisote entry since 2008. His last two bets in the festival, namely,

    Iskul Bukol 20 Years After and Ang Darling Kong Aswang, did not include Kristine in the final cast. Although Enteng Kabisote will make its return this year in the up­coming festival, Vic’s leading lady of choice this time around is pretty newcomer Gwen Zamora. She will portray the role previously assumed by Kristine, Faye. Kristine, who was last seen on the big screen via Star Cinema’s 2008 drama-romance film My Big Love, said she’s yearning to do another movie but the lack of an appealing project inhibits her from making a comeback.
    “Gustong-gusto ko talaga guma­wa ng pelikula,” confided Kristine. “Pero ‘yon nga lang, as of the mo­ment wala pa talagang magandang material for me. I can wait until meron.”

    WANTS MOVIE WITH JERICHO. If Kristine had her way, she would like to work again with former love team partner Jericho Rosales, who also happens to be her ex-boyfriend.

    The two were one of the most popular love teams back in the early millennium. The success of their television shows together like Pan­gako Sa ‘Yo (2000) and Sana’y Wala Nang Wakas (2003), along with film projects Forevermore (2002) and Ngayong Nandito Ka (2003), attest to their drawing power as a couple.
    Jericho and Kristine were re­united in 2009 through ABS-CBN’s drama-romance series titled Dahil May Isang Ikaw. But a possible new movie with Jericho, said Kristine, will perhaps excite the old fans even more.
